Q: Is 1,198,830 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,198,830 is a composite number.

Why is 1,198,830 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,198,830 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 10 15 30 89 178 267 445 449 534 890 898 1,335 1,347 2,245 2,670 2,694 4,490 6,735 13,470 39,961 79,922 119,883 199,805 239,766 399,610 599,415 and 1,198,830, with no remainder.

Since 1,198,830 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,198,830, it is a composite number.
